How Frosts, Freezes, and Hard Freezes Differ - ThoughtCo

WebOct 4, 2024 · Frost versus freezing. A frost occurs when air temperatures dip to 32 degrees Fahrenheit or lower at ground level. With a frost, the water within plant tissue may or may not actually freeze, depending on other conditions. A frost becomes a freeze event when ice forms within and between the cell walls of plant tissue.
